Welcome to Kamalani Lodge, a cozy and well-appointed retreat designed for comfort and relaxation, just a short 6-minute drive from Hawai‘i Volcanoes National Park.
After a day of exploring Hawaiʻi Volcanoes National Park, relax in the living room beside the warm gas fireplace and enjoy a 65” TV—perfect for a peaceful movie night. Two of the bedrooms also include their own TVs for added comfort and privacy.
The primary bedroom features a California King bed, while the guest bedroom offers a Queen bed. Both include electric bed warmers for those cool Volcano evenings.
In addition, the home includes a private fireplace bonus room with its own exterior entrance—an inviting flex space that provides extra room to spread out. It features a full-size futon ideal for one adult or two children, along with a cozy electric fireplace, creating a second warm retreat to read, relax, or unwind.
A dedicated workspace is available for remote work or planning your next island adventures.
Kamalani Lodge includes a fully equipped kitchen with everything needed to prepare meals, plus a spacious front porch with comfortable seating—perfect for morning coffee and cool Volcano evenings.
You’ll enjoy convenient access to local favorites like Volcano Winery, the Volcano Village Farmers Market, the nearby golf course, and a community park with a playground and skate area.
“Kamalani” means “heavenly child” in Hawaiian, reflecting the peaceful spirit of this special retreat—a welcoming place to slow down, recharge, and experience the beauty of Volcano.

About the area
Volcano
Ohia Estates, a neighbourhood in Volcano, is home to this cottage. Volcano House and Volcano Garden Arts are local landmarks, and some of the area's attractions include Aloha Candy Company and Akatsuka Orchid Gardens. Volcano Art Center and Gallery and Hilo Coffee Mill are also worth visiting.
